What significant trend has been observed regarding autism cases over the past 50 years?

Explanation:
The significant trend observed regarding autism cases over the past 50 years is reflected in the answer that indicates an increase from one case in 8,000 to one case in 50. This statistic illustrates a dramatic rise in the number of diagnosed autism cases, highlighting both a genuine increase in prevalence and an improved understanding and recognition of autism spectrum disorders. The past few decades have seen advancements in diagnostic criteria, awareness, and education around autism, leading to more children being identified and diagnosed earlier. This trend is supported by research showing that the definitions of autism have expanded over time to encompass a wider range of symptoms and behaviors, which has likely contributed to the increased diagnostic rates. Moreover, as society becomes more aware of autism and its various manifestations, families are more likely to seek evaluations and interventions, further influencing the increase in recorded cases.
